When we talk about the King of K-Pop, the name that frequently comes up is G-Dragon. This isn't just because he’s a talented performer, but because he's redefined what it means to be a K-pop idol. From his early days with BIGBANG, G-Dragon showed an extraordinary ability to write and produce hit songs that resonated not just in Korea but globally. Tracks like "Fantastic Baby" and "Bang Bang Bang" became anthems that propelled K-pop into the international spotlight. What sets G-Dragon apart is his distinctive style and artistic vision. He’s not just following trends; he’s setting them. His fashion sense is constantly watched and copied, and his music experiments with different genres, pushing the boundaries of what K-pop can be. Beyond the music, G-Dragon has also influenced the broader cultural landscape, collaborating with major fashion brands and becoming a recognizable figure in the global arts scene. His impact extends to aspiring artists who see him as a role model, someone who carved his path with authenticity and innovation. He has proven himself to be a powerhouse in the K-pop industry through numerous achievements and accolades. G-Dragon's consistent presence on music charts, sold-out concerts, and numerous awards underline his sustained popularity and influence. He has also been praised for his ability to connect with audiences on a personal level, using his music and platform to address social issues and inspire positive change. In summary, G-Dragon's claim to the title of "King of K-Pop" is built on his pioneering spirit, exceptional talent, and enduring influence in music, fashion, and culture.
Other Contenders for the Throne
While G-Dragon often leads the conversation, it’s essential to acknowledge other incredibly influential figures who have significantly shaped K-pop. These artists have also left indelible marks on the industry and have strong claims to the title in their own right. These names are often mentioned when fans discuss who the King of K-pop is. One such name is Rain, who, in the early 2000s, was a global phenomenon. His album "It’s Raining" was a massive hit, and he successfully transitioned into acting, starring in popular dramas like "Full House." Rain's influence extends beyond music and television; he has also made a mark in Hollywood, further broadening K-pop's reach. His early success paved the way for many K-pop acts to follow, and his entrepreneurial ventures have shown a different side of what a K-pop star can achieve.
Then there’s Taeyang from BIGBANG, known for his soulful voice and exceptional stage presence. As a member of one of K-pop's most successful groups, Taeyang has also had a strong solo career with hits like "Eyes, Nose, Lips." His music often explores deeper themes, and he’s respected for his artistry and dedication to his craft. His influence comes not just from his hits but from the respect he commands within the industry as a true vocalist and performer. SHINee’s Taemin is another artist who deserves recognition. Starting as a young member of SHINee, Taemin has grown into a captivating solo artist known for his complex choreography and captivating performances. His transition from a group member to a successful solo artist demonstrates his versatility and commitment to pushing his boundaries. He has inspired many younger artists with his work ethic and willingness to experiment with different styles.
Super Junior also cannot be left out of the conversation, they have had a huge impact on the globalization of K-pop. As one of the first groups to gain massive popularity across Asia, Super Junior played a crucial role in expanding K-pop's reach beyond Korea. Their hit songs and variety show appearances helped introduce K-pop to a wider audience, laying the groundwork for the global phenomenon we see today. Each of these artists has brought something unique to the table, contributing to the diverse and dynamic nature of K-pop. While they might not always be labeled as the "King of K-Pop," their influence and achievements are undeniable. They represent different eras and aspects of K-pop, each leaving a lasting legacy that continues to shape the industry.
What Qualities Define a "King" in K-Pop?
So, what exactly makes someone worthy of being called the "King of K-Pop?" It's not just about having hit songs or a large fan base. It's a combination of factors that demonstrate lasting impact and influence. One of the key qualities is innovation. The King of K-Pop should be someone who pushes the boundaries of music, fashion, and performance. They should be willing to experiment with new sounds and styles, setting trends rather than following them. G-Dragon, for example, is renowned for his ability to blend different genres and create unique sounds that resonate with a global audience. Rain was one of the first K-pop stars to break into Hollywood, opening doors for others.
Longevity is another crucial factor. The King of K-Pop should have a career that spans many years, with consistent success and relevance. They should be able to adapt to changing trends and maintain a strong fan base over time. This requires not just talent but also hard work and dedication. Super Junior, for example, has been active for over a decade, adapting to different musical styles and maintaining their popularity through various activities. Influence is also paramount. The King of K-Pop should have a significant impact on the industry and inspire other artists. They should be a role model for aspiring performers, setting a high standard of excellence and professionalism. Taemin, for example, has inspired many younger artists with his dedication to perfecting his craft and his willingness to take risks.
Global recognition is increasingly important in today's K-pop landscape. The King of K-Pop should have a strong international fan base and be recognized as a global star. They should be able to connect with audiences from different cultures and break down language barriers. BIGBANG, with hits like "Fantastic Baby," helped to propel K-pop onto the world stage, gaining fans from all corners of the globe. Ultimately, the title of "King of K-Pop" is subjective and open to interpretation. Different fans will have different opinions based on their preferences and values. However, by considering these qualities, we can better understand what it takes to achieve legendary status in the K-pop world. It’s about more than just popularity; it’s about leaving a lasting legacy.
